    Position Overview:


    We are looking for a detail-oriented and experienced Data Migration Specialist to lead the migration of critical data from legacy systems to Teamcenter, our chosen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) platform.

    The successful candidate will play a key role in ensuring the accuracy, completeness, and integrity of data throughout the migration process.

    This role requires strong analytical skills, a deep understanding of data structures/models, and proficiency in Teamcenter.


    Key Responsibilities:
    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and data migration requirements and objectives.

    Assess existing data sources, including databases, spreadsheets, and other repositories, to identify data to be migrated.

    Develop and implement data migration strategies and plans, ensuring minimal disruption to ongoing operations.

    Design and execute data extraction, transformation, and loading (ETL) processes to migrate data into Teamcenter.

    Validate migrated data to ensure accuracy, completeness, and consistency with defined quality standards.

    Troubleshoot and resolve data migration issues, working closely with stakeholders and IT teams as needed.

    Document migration processes, procedures, and outcomes for future reference and auditing purposes.

    Provide training and support to end-users to facilitate a smooth transition to the new system.

    Continuously monitor data quality and integrity post-migration, addressing any discrepancies or anomalies promptly.


    Qualifications:
    Proven experience 7+ in data migration projects, with a focus on PLM systems such as Teamcenter.

    SQL, Python, TCXML development experience

    In-depth knowledge of data migration best practices, methodologies, and tools.

    Strong understanding of data modeling, relational databases, and SQL queries.

    Proficiency in Teamcenter, including data model configuration, workflows, and customization.

    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to troubleshoot complex issues.

    Effective communication skills, with the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ams and articulate techn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.

    Detail-oriented mindset with a commitment to data accuracy and quality.

    Experience with other PLM systems and CAD/CAM software (desirable).
